Day 1:

Breakfast at Café Einstein

Start your day with a traditional German breakfast at this charming café known for its Viennese coffeehouse atmosphere.

,

Visit the Brandenburg Gate

Explore this iconic symbol of Berlin, a neoclassical monument that embodies the city's history and unity.

,

Walk through Tiergarten

Stroll through Berlin's largest park, a serene oasis perfect for an afternoon walk and people-watching.

,

Lunch at Markthalle Neun

Visit this vibrant food market in Kreuzberg for a casual lunch, offering a variety of local and international dishes.

,

Explore East Side Gallery

Walk along the longest remaining section of the Berlin Wall, now an open-air gallery featuring murals from artists worldwide.

,

Visit the Berlin Wall Memorial

Learn about the history of the Berlin Wall and its impact on the city at this informative site with a preserved section of the wall.

,

Dinner at a local restaurant

Enjoy a traditional German dinner at a local eatery. Try dishes like currywurst or schnitzel.

,

Evening walk along the Spree River

Take a peaceful evening stroll along the river, enjoying the illuminated cityscape and the atmosphere.
